About the Author

Chelsea Monroe-Cassel is the coauthor of A Feast of Ice and Fire: The Official Game of Thrones Companion Cookbook and the author of World of Warcraft: The Official Cookbook, Hearthstone: Innkeeper's Tavern Cookbook, and The Elder Scrolls: The Official Cookbook. Her work is a synthesis of imagination and historical research. This passion has led her to a career of transforming imaginary foods into reality. She greatly enjoys foreign languages, treasure hunting, history, and all things related to honey.

Reviewed in Australia on 29 March 2021
Verified Purchase
Bought this as a gift for my wife who has around 2000 hours in Skyrim, and it is a beautifully presented book, to be sure (as a gift, pop the rating up to 4.5 or even 5 stars).

In terms of the actual functional content, I need to warn prospective buyers that the recipes within are highly oriented towards bakers - recreating the legendary Sweetroll, baked lollies and other in-game favourites. For the more savoury minded, the highlights are probably the spice mixes at the front; we've got a lot of mileage from the Stormcloak seasoning in omelettes and other concoctions. The other recipes are pretty basic; a workable cheese and potato soup is delicious, the Redguard Rice a little blander - are there no chilis in Tamriel? By Talos, it needs more punch!

Ultimately, what you are buying with this cookbook is an invitation to dream more in the kitchen, and this book delivers that. Let the recipes herein serve as a springboard to higher levels of Alchemical and Provisioning experimentation.

Tiffany
5.0 out of 5 stars Roleplay style writing
Reviewed in the United States on 24 March 2024
Verified Purchase
This book is in theme with skyrim. It is set up to be as though you can actually find this book in skyrim. It's absolutely gorgeous. There's a lot of additional artwork from the game itself. There's a lot of lore additions such as the origins of food, and the races that eat that food. It is really really fun because it is written in the way that a Skyrim author might have written it. It's absolutely gorgeous and all accounts. And I was able to make a recipe for my birthday out of this book and it was the tastiest thing I've ever made. Additionally, the artwork is far more intricate than a cookbook might need, but that adds to the beautiful charm of this book. I absolutely love everything about this. They also give you custom recipes for seasonings to use for other core recipes of this book. And they give the spices custom spice names such as: Nord spices, stormcloak seasoning, and imperial seasoning.
This is possibly the most beautiful cookbook I have ever purchased and I do not regret a single penny that was spent on this book. This book is such high quality I simply cannot comprehend it at times.
